Ricotta cheese is a dairy food. A 100 g edible portion provides 150 calories, 7.5 g of protein, 7.3 g of carbohydrate and 10.2 g of fat. That works out to 5 g of protein per 100 calories. By its ingredients it is vegetarian and gluten-free. All figures are per 100 g and trace to USDA FoodData Central.

Nutrition
5 g protein / 100 kcal
Energy
- Energy150 kcal
Macronutrients
- Protein7.54 g15%
- Carbohydrate7.27 g3%
- Fiber0 g0%
- Total sugars0.27 g
- Total fat10.18 g13%
- Saturated fat6.42 g32%
Minerals
- Sodium110 mg5%
- Potassium219 mg5%
- Calcium206 mg16%
- Iron0.13 mg1%
- Magnesium20 mg5%
Vitamins
- Vitamin C0 mg0%
- Vitamin D—
% Daily Value based on FDA reference amounts for a general adult diet. Individual needs vary. Missing values are shown as “—”, never zero.
